About Cornell Creek Park in Hillsboro

Cornell Creek Park is a four-acre public park located in Hillsboro, Oregon. The park features paved, looped walking paths that provide visitors with opportunities for leisurely strolls or light exercise. One of the park's main attractions is a half-acre fenced off-leash dog area, where canine companions can play and socialize safely.

For families with children, Cornell Creek Park offers a small nature play area. This area includes a sand play space along the creek, allowing kids to engage in imaginative and tactile experiences. The park's layout is split into two sections by a driveway leading to a nearby condominium development, with the southern portion housing the off-leash dog area.

The park provides a blend of natural and developed spaces, making it suitable for various recreational activities. Its location within a residential area makes it a convenient spot for local residents to enjoy outdoor time and community gatherings.
